Output 84bf17973394de23aead5d916bad80ab6886284a9cfdeb243b2b7985b6ea1a81:0

value
133640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 67a0563f3b63ca201a4bf7c38a704cebc61c1142 OP_EQUALVERIFY OP_CHECKSIG
address
1ASvgAPLYu488oeTuriyN8VGrnJPswLXUf
transaction
84bf17973394de23aead5d916bad80ab6886284a9cfdeb243b2b7985b6ea1a81
confirmations
582351
spent
true